Wearing Green on St. Patrick’s Day is not an Irish tradition. Americans celebrate St. Patrick’s Day differently than the Irish do. Celebrating St. Patrick’s Day in Ireland To celebrate in Ireland, people pin a small bunch of Shamrocks to the right side of their shirt. The Shamrocks are worn to signify one’s Irishness and the traditional connection with St. Patrick.
